How long does it take light to travel through a 3.2-mm-thick piece of window glass? Express your answer in seconds.
time = distance / speed
speed of light in material medium v= c/n
time t = d*n/v and refractive index of glass n = 1.5
time t = {(3.2 mm)*1.5}/(3*108 m/s)= (3.2*10-3 * 1.5 )/ (3*108 ) = 1.6*10-11 seconds
time t = 1.6*10-11 seconds
